Do you know many types of surface finishesare available on stainless steels?

Surface Finish Code

Description

Mill finishes

 

1D

Hot rolled, heat treated, pickled. The most common hot rolled finish. A non reflective, rough surface. Not normally used for decorative applications

2B

Cold rolled, heat treated, pickled, pinch passed. The most common cold rolled mill finish. Dull grey slightly reflective finish. Can be used in this condition or frequently is the starting point for a wide range of polished finishes.

2D

Cold rolled, heat treated, pickled.

2H

Work hardened by rolling to give enhanced strength level. Various ranges of tensile or 0.2% proof strength are given in EN 10088-2 up to 1300 MPa and 1100 MPa respectively dependent on grade

2Q

Cold rolled hardened and tempered. Applies to martensitic steels which respond to this kind of heat treatment.

2R

Cold rolled and bright annealed, still commonly known as BA. A bright reflective finish. Can be used in this condition or as the starting point for polishing or other surface treatment processes e.g. colouring

 

In the following codes “1” refers to hot rolled being the starting point and “2” as cold rolled

Special Finishes

 

1G or 2G

Ground. Relatively coarse surface. Unidirectional. Grade of polishing grit or surface roughness can be specified

1J or 2J

Brushed or dull polished. Smoother than 1G/2G. Grade of polishing grit or surface roughness can be specified

1K or 2K

Satin polish. Similar to 1J/2J but with maximum specified Ra value of 0.5 micron. Usually achieved with SiC polishing belts. Alumina belts are strongly discouraged for this finish as this will have detrimental effect on corrosion resistance. Recommended for external architectural and coastal environments where bright polish (1P/2P) is not acceptable.

1P/2P

Bright polished. Non-directional, reflective. Can specify maximum surface roughness. The best surface for corrosion resistance.

2L

Coloured by chemical process to thicken the passive layer and produce interference colours. A wide range of colours is possible.

1M/2M

Patterned. One surface flat.

1S/2S

Surface coated e.g. with tin = Terne coating

2W

Corrugated. Similar to patterned but both surfaces are affected

Bead blasting

Not in EN 10088-2. Work being undertaken to more accurately define finishes.
